EDELWEISS PARK
Edelweiss Park is accessible via the nearby expressways - Pan Island Expressway (PIE), Tampines Expressway (TPE) and East Coast Parkway (ECP). It takes only 5 minutes or less to commute to the Changi Airport.
It takes about 5 minutes drive or take a bus ride to the nearest Pasir Ris MRT station. Nearby amenities include Loyang Point, White Sands, Tampines Mall, Century Square, The Japanese School Tanah Merah & Laguna Golf and Country Club.
